Đây là lệnh svn-mailer có thể chạy trong nhà cung cấp dịch vụ lưu trữ miễn phí OnWorks bằng cách sử dụng một trong nhiều máy trạm trực tuyến miễn phí của chúng tôi như Ubuntu Online, Fedora Online, trình giả lập trực tuyến Windows hoặc trình giả lập trực tuyến MAC OS
CHƯƠNG TRÌNH:
TÊN
svn-mailer - Một công cụ thông báo cam kết lật đổ nhiều tính năng
SYNOPSIS
svn-mailer --làm -d còn lại -r vòng quay [-f cấu hình]
svn-mailer --propchange -d còn lại -r vòng quay -a tác giả -n tên đệm
[-o hoạt động] [-f cấu hình]
svn-mailer --Khóa -d còn lại -a tác giả [-f cấu hình]
svn-mailer --mở khóa -d còn lại -a tác giả [-f cấu hình]
MÔ TẢ
Gói svnmailer là một công cụ để đăng thông báo về các sự kiện lật đổ đến các
mục tiêu theo những cách khác nhau. Hiện được triển khai: Thư qua SMTP hoặc đường ống sendmail, tin tức
qua NNTP, XML qua XMLRPC tới trình theo dõi CIA (xem http://cia.navi.cx/ để biết chi tiết).
Sản phẩm svn-mailer script dòng lệnh thường được gọi thông qua cơ chế hook của subversion,
nhưng bạn cũng có thể chạy nó theo cách thủ công. Điều này rất hữu ích để gửi lại các tin nhắn bị thiếu hoặc cho
mục đích gỡ lỗi. Hãy nhớ bắt đầu nó dưới id người dùng / nhóm chính xác. Nếu không thì nó
có thể gặp sự cố khi mở kho lưu trữ hoặc tệp cấu hình.
Trong hầu hết các trường hợp, svnmailer có thể được sử dụng như một ứng dụng thay thế cho mailer.py phân phối
với sự lật đổ. Có một số khác biệt nhỏ dành riêng cho nhiều hành vi hơn
Tính nhất quán. (Hy vọng) tất cả chúng đều được nêu trong tài liệu HTML.
CÁC VẤN ĐỀ CHUNG LỰA CHỌN
--phiên bản
hiển thị số phiên bản của chương trình và thoát
-h, --Cứu giúp
hiển thị thông báo trợ giúp và thoát
CHUNG THÔNG SỐ
--gỡ lỗi
Chạy ở chế độ gỡ lỗi (về cơ bản có nghĩa là tất cả các tin nhắn được gửi đến STDOUT)
-dKHO LƯU TRỮ, --kho=KHO
Thư mục kho lưu trữ
-fCẤU HÌNH, --config=CẤU HÌNH
Tệp cấu hình
-ePATH_ENCODING, - mã hóa đường dẫn=ĐƯỜNG_ENCODING
Chỉ định mã hóa ký tự được sử dụng cho tên tệp. Theo mặc định, mã hóa
được cố gắng xác định tự động tùy thuộc vào ngôn ngữ.
HÀNH VI LỰA CHỌN
Các tùy chọn hành vi loại trừ lẫn nhau, tức là tùy chọn cuối cùng sẽ thắng.
-c, --làm
Đây là một cam kết thông thường của dữ liệu được phiên bản (móc sau cam kết). Đây là mặc định.
-p, --propchange
Đây là một sửa đổi của các thuộc tính chưa được phiên bản (móc nối thay đổi post-revprop)
-l, --Khóa
(svn 1.2 trở lên) Đây là lệnh gọi khóa (móc sau khóa). Tên tệp bị khóa
được đọc từ STDIN.
-u, --mở khóa
(svn 1.2 trở lên) Đây là cuộc gọi mở khóa (móc sau mở khóa). Tệp đã mở khóa
tên được đọc từ STDIN.
BỔ SUNG THÔNG SỐ
-rREVISION, --ôn tập=TÁI TẠO
Số sửa đổi đã cam kết / đã sửa đổi
-aTÁC GIẢ, --tác giả=TÁC GIẢ
Tác giả của sửa đổi
-nPROPNAME, --propname=TÊN ĐỀ XUẤT
Tên của thuộc tính đã sửa đổi
-oHÀNH ĐỘNG, --hoạt động=HÀNH ĐỘNG
(svn 1.2 trở lên) Hành động thay đổi thuộc tính. Nếu được chỉ định, thuộc tính cũ
giá trị được đọc từ STDIN.
CẤU HÌNH CÁC TẬP TIN
Nếu tệp cấu hình không được chỉ định trên dòng lệnh, nó sẽ được tìm kiếm theo mặc định
các địa điểm. Cái đầu tiên được tìm thấy đã được tải. Các vị trí, theo thứ tự: svnmailer.conf in
các conf / thư mục của kho lưu trữ đã cho, svnmailer.conf trong thư mục script
chinh no, /etc/svnmailer.conf.
CŨ STYLE COMMAND ĐƯỜNG DÂY
Ngoài ra, bạn có thể sử dụng các dòng lệnh tương thích kiểu cũ (các tùy chọn được mô tả
ở trên không áp dụng sau đó):
svn-mailer cam kết còn lại vòng quay [cấu hình]
svn-mailer sự thay đổi còn lại vòng quay tác giả tên đệm [cấu hình]
Với svn 1.2 trở lên:
svn-mailer propchange2 còn lại vòng quay tác giả tên đệm hoạt động [cấu hình]
svn-mailer khóa còn lại tác giả [cấu hình]
svn-mailer mở khóa còn lại tác giả [cấu hình]
BÁO CÁO GIỎI
Nếu bạn tìm thấy lỗi hoặc có ý tưởng về cách cải thiện svnmailer, vui lòng gửi thư tới
<[email được bảo vệ]>.
TÁC GIẢ THÔNG TIN
André "nd" Malo[email được bảo vệ]>, GPG: 0x8103A37E
Sử dụng svn-mailer trực tuyến bằng các dịch vụ onworks.net